    I think it is 'the back to work meeting' on the 9th of January. I will be going. They keep you motivated & up to date. Alyson was at our table at the last regional meeting, Monday.

    I have to drive an hour myself, but have only ever missed one & I find when I don't attend meetings, I don't feel part of it and get a bit slack.

    Just make sure you do follow up calls (courtesy calls) with your customers a week or 2 after the party, thank them for their order and offer them 10% discount for future re-orders. Let them know you will keep in touch via e-mail re-specials and contact them 3 months later to ask if need to re-order.

    I have not always done this, but feel I have to if I want to keep my business going.
